This Antique Lawyer's Office Chair was refinished at some point, and features tiger sawn oak, rolled arms curved back, and dates from the turn of the century (1890s to 1900s). This antique office chair has finish that has held up well; there is a crack in the scooped out solid seat, but it is structurally sound. It rests upon a re-fabricated four-legged base, as the original legs were damaged. It usually takes a curved piece of wood that hides on the joints on the office chair base and we will detail that out before shipping if you remind us at the time of the sale. The chair tilts, swivels and adjusts up and down. The color matches the roll top we have listed currently really well nicely if you are looking for an office set. The overall size is 21 inches wide across the seat, 18 inches deep, 23 inches wide on the arms, 17 inches high on the seat as pictured and 32 inches high as pictured.
